First in-game images from the upcoming LotR title.


Pandemic Studios today announced earlier this week that it has begun developing The Lord of the Ring: Conquest for the PlayStation 3, Xbox 360, Nintendo DS, and the PC. It is currently slated for a fall 2008 release.

“Our Pandemic Studios creative teams have years of expertise bringing giant battlefields to life,” says Andrew Goldman, Pandemic Studios co-founder and general manager.

“We’ve always wanted to harness our experience in a fantasy universe with warriors, archers, mages and castle sieges. Of course, there is truly no better fantasy world to recreate than the enormity of The Lord of the Rings realm.”
Conquest is described as an “action packed game” which will allow players to engage in epic battles while playing as either the heroes of middle Earth, or its various foes under the command of Sauron.

Electronic Arts has now released the first batch of high-res in-game screenshots, which you can find in the game's image gallery here on GWN by clicking on the thumbnails above this post. Enjoy!
